Разгадка тайны Нирджхора: руководство для начинающих по пониманию Нирджхора и его пути программирования

Привет, уважаемые любители программирования! Сегодня мы окунемся в интригующий мир Нирджхора — талантливого человека, страстно увлеченного кодированием и разработкой программного обеспечения. В этом сообщении блога мы рассмотрим различные методы, которые Нирджор использует в своем путешествии по программированию, используя разговорный язык и примеры кода, чтобы сделать его интересным и простым для понимания. Итак, начнем!

  1. Магия HTML и CSS.
    Приключения Нирджхора в программировании начались с HTML и CSS — строительных блоков Интернета. Он научился создавать потрясающие веб-страницы, используя теги HTML для структурирования контента и стили CSS, чтобы сделать их визуально привлекательными. Вот простой пример:
<!DOCTYPE html>
<html>
<head>
  <title>Hello, Nirjhor!</title>
  <style>
    body {
      background-color: #f1f1f1;
      font-family: Arial, sans-serif;
    }
    h1 {
      color: #333;
      text-align: center;
    }
  </style>
</head>
<body>
  <h1>Hello, Nirjhor!</h1>
</body>
</html>
  1. Мастерство JavaScript:
    Чтобы добавить интерактивности своим веб-страницам, Нирджхор углубился в JavaScript. С помощью этого динамического языка программирования он мог создавать привлекательный пользовательский интерфейс и добавлять функциональность в свои проекты. Вот простой пример функции JavaScript:
function greet(name) {
  console.log(`Hello, ${name}!`);
}
greet('Nirjhor');
  1. Мастерство Python:
    Нирджхор расширил свой репертуар программирования, освоив Python — универсальный и мощный язык. Он использовал Python для различных целей, таких как веб-разработка, анализ данных и автоматизация. Вот фрагмент, который вычисляет факториал числа в Python:
def factorial(n):
  if n == 0:
    return 1
  else:
    return n * factorial(n - 1)
result = factorial(5)
print(result)
  1. Контроль версий с помощью Git.
    По мере того, как Нирджхор работал над более сложными проектами, он осознавал важность контроля версий. Git стал его союзником в отслеживании изменений, сотрудничестве с другими и возврате к предыдущим версиям, когда это необходимо. Вот простой рабочий процесс Git:
git init
git add .
git commit -m "Initial commit"
git push origin master
  1. Чудеса объектно-ориентированного программирования.
    Чтобы улучшить свои навыки программирования и создавать масштабируемые приложения, Нирджхор занялся объектно-ориентированным программированием (ООП). Он научился создавать классы, объекты и методы, что позволило ему эффективно организовывать код. Вот пример Python:
class Car:
  def __init__(self, brand, model):
    self.brand = brand
    self.model = model
  def drive(self):
    print(f"Driving a {self.brand} {self.model}.")
my_car = Car("Tesla", "Model 3")
my_car.drive()

Объединив эти методы и навыки, Нирджор стал опытным программистом, постоянно расширяя свои знания и исследуя новые технологии. Его путь служит источником вдохновения для начинающих программистов по всему миру.

В заключение, путь Нирджхора в программировании охватывает HTML и CSS для веб-разработки, JavaScript для интерактивности, Python для универсальности, Git для контроля версий и объектно-ориентированное программирование для масштабируемости. Каждый метод имеет свое уникальное очарование и полезность в обширной сфере программирования.

Итак, отправляйтесь в собственное приключение по программированию, учитесь на опыте Нирджхора и дайте волю своему воображению в мире программирования!